
Excel每列怎么单独成页的方法包括:使用打印选项、拆分工作表、使用VBA宏、数据透视表。以下将详细介绍其中的“使用打印选项”方法。
在Excel中,如果你需要将每一列数据单独打印成一页,可以使用打印选项来实现。具体步骤如下:
- 选择打印区域:首先选择你要打印的整个数据区域。
- 设置打印区域:点击“页面布局”选项卡,然后点击“打印区域”->“设置打印区域”。
- 调整页面设置:点击“文件”->“打印”,在打印设置中选择“每页的页数”下拉菜单,然后选择“一列”。
- 预览和打印:点击“打印预览”查看效果,确保每列数据都在单独的一页上,然后点击“打印”。
详细描述:
调整页面设置:在调整页面设置时,确保选择“一列”选项,这样Excel会自动将每列数据放在单独的一页上。这对于打印包含多个列的复杂数据非常有用,因为它可以帮助你更清晰地查看和整理数据。
一、打印选项
1、选择打印区域
首先,选择你要打印的整个数据区域。这一步骤非常关键,因为它直接关系到你后续的打印效果。选择数据区域时,务必确保包含你想要打印的所有列和行。
2、设置打印区域
在选择好数据区域后,进入“页面布局”选项卡,然后点击“打印区域”->“设置打印区域”。这一步骤将确定你选中的区域作为打印范围,避免在打印时包含不必要的数据。
3、调整页面设置
点击“文件”->“打印”,在打印设置中选择“每页的页数”下拉菜单,然后选择“一列”。这一步骤非常关键,因为它决定了每列数据将被单独打印在一页上。你还可以根据需要调整其他打印设置,如纸张大小、页边距等。
4、预览和打印
在调整好所有设置后,点击“打印预览”查看效果,确保每列数据都在单独的一页上。如果预览效果满意,点击“打印”将数据打印出来。
二、拆分工作表
1、复制数据到新工作表
将每列数据复制到新的工作表中,这是实现每列数据单独成页的另一种方法。首先,右键点击数据列的顶部字母,然后选择“复制”。接着,创建一个新的工作表,并将数据粘贴到该工作表中。
2、重复步骤直到完成
对于每一列数据,重复上述步骤,直到所有列数据都已被复制到新的工作表中。这种方法虽然繁琐,但可以确保每列数据都能单独打印成页。
3、打印单独的工作表
在完成所有数据列的复制后,可以分别打印每一个新的工作表。这样,每一列数据将被单独打印成页。
三、使用VBA宏
1、打开VBA编辑器
VBA(Visual Basic for Applications)宏是Excel中的一种强大工具,可以帮助你自动化许多任务。首先,按下“Alt + F11”打开VBA编辑器。
2、编写VBA代码
在VBA编辑器中,插入一个新的模块,并编写以下代码:
Sub PrintEachColumn()
Dim ws As Worksheet
Dim col As Integer
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为你的工作表名称
For col = 1 To ws.UsedRange.Columns.Count
ws.Columns(col).Select
ws.PageSetup.PrintArea = Selection.Address
ws.PrintOut
Next col
End Sub
这段代码将遍历每一列,并将其设置为打印区域,然后逐一打印。
3、运行VBA宏
在编写好代码后,按下“F5”运行宏。这样,每列数据将被单独打印成页。
四、数据透视表
1、创建数据透视表
数据透视表是Excel中一种强大的数据分析工具。首先,选择你的数据区域,然后点击“插入”->“数据透视表”。选择将数据透视表放置在新的工作表中。
2、设置数据透视表字段
在数据透视表字段列表中,拖动你要分析的列到“行标签”区域。这样,每一列数据将被单独显示在数据透视表中。
3、打印数据透视表
在设置好数据透视表后,可以分别打印每一个数据透视表项。这样,每一列数据将被单独打印成页。
五、总结
通过以上几种方法,你可以轻松地将Excel中的每列数据单独打印成页。使用打印选项是最简单的方法,但如果你需要更多的控制和自动化,可以考虑使用VBA宏或拆分工作表。数据透视表则适用于需要进行数据分析和汇总的场景。无论采用哪种方法,都能帮助你更有效地管理和打印Excel数据。
相关问答FAQs:
Q: 在Excel中如何将每列单独成页?
A: 你可以按照以下步骤将Excel中的每列分别放在单独的页中:
Q: 如何将Excel表格的每列分别打印在不同的页上?
A: 如果你想要将Excel表格的每列分别打印在不同的页上,可以按照以下步骤操作:
Q: 如何将Excel表格中的每列拆分为单独的工作表?
A: 如果你需要将Excel表格中的每列拆分为单独的工作表,可以按照以下步骤进行操作:
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4529496